C—dump变换器开关的工作方式及其对调速系统的影响

摘    要:讨论无刷直流电机调速系统中C-dump(电容储能型)变换器新波开关的工作方式对变换器储能电容电压和电机电流的影响,对斩波开关提出了三种控制方法:滞环控制、PWM控制以及滞环结合PWM控制。本文对其与主开关的配合方式进行了详细的分析与比较,给出了系统在各种方式下的实验结果。研究表明,C-dump变换器的新波开关采用滞环控制与PWM控制相结合的工作能较好的减小电机电流脉动,进而减小电磁转矩脉动,有利于系统稳态性能的提高。

关 键 词:无刷电机  C-dump变换器  电流脉动  储能电容  斩波开关

Abstract:Influence on the current and the torque ripple with the switch operating model of a PMBDC motor based on C dump converter is analyzed. In order to improve the performance of the system and to cut down the torque ripple, several kind co operations of the chopping switch and the power switch are proposed, such as lag loop control, PWM control and lag loop with PWM control. And they are studied and compared in both theory and practice. Simulational and experimental waves are also offered. The results indicate that lag loop with PWM control on the chopping switch can reduce the ripple of the phase current and the torque. It can fairly meet the request of the system.
